The Cannon Cast Episode 111: All the good vibes gone

Last week, we were pretty upbeat about the Columbus Blue Jackets and they were starting to pull us back in. They had come off two consecutive wins at the Carolina Hurricanes in overtime and shootout and we thought ‘here they come.’

After a week that saw them garner just one measly point and getting swept — thoroughly outplayed at the Detroit Red Wings — the good vibes are long gone. The Jackets have slipped to sixth in the Central Division and the Nashville Predators have roared back with five-straight victories to take the last playoff spot.

Losers of four in a row, Columbus now finds themselves just one win ahead of the Red Wings in the standings, and six points above the Central Division basement.
